1. Reinventing a Classic Villain
Doctor Doom, whose real name is Victor Von Doom, is a complex character with a rich backstory. As the ruler of Latveria, Doom is a brilliant scientist and sorcerer with a deep-seated vendetta against the Fantastic Four and other Marvel heroes. Historically portrayed as a menacing yet charismatic antagonist, Doctor Doom’s role in the MCU would require a nuanced performance that balances ruthlessness with a compelling personal code.
Robert Downey Jr. is known for his ability to bring depth to his characters, blending charm, intensity, and vulnerability. His portrayal of Tony Stark demonstrated his skill in delivering a multi-dimensional performance, making him a fitting candidate to tackle Doctor Doom’s intricate persona. Downey Jr.’s knack for blending gravitas with charisma could offer a fresh take on Doom, bringing a new dimension to the character.
